Slavery: UN calls for widespread reparations

A UN Committee has recommended that signatory states of the International Convention on the Elimination of All Forms of Racial Discrimination implement reparative measures for people of African descent. This document, approved by 18 independent experts, proposes a new interpretation of the Convention adopted in 1969, emphasizing that obligations to combat racial discrimination include reparations for harms related to the transatlantic slave trade.
